United States’s Oil Consumption was reported at 20,455.668 Barrel/Day th in Dec 2018. This records an increase from the previous number of 19,957.723 Barrel/Day th for Dec 2017. United States’s Oil Consumption data is updated yearly, averaging 17,721.826 Barrel/Day th from Dec 1965 to 2018, with 54 observations. The oil industry extracted a record high 4.0 billion barrels of crude oil in the United States in 2018, worth an average wellhead price of US$61 per barrel. The 2018 production exceeded the previous record of 3.5 billion barrels set in 1970. 2018 oil production was more than double the production ten years earlier,
